Alan Winfield left this review about Wellington Inn
The Wellington Inn is a decent looking pub that is set sideways onto the road,the pub is situated on Eastwoods main shopping street.
Once inside there are a few different rooms and i have found this to be a nice pub to have a drink in,the pub used to be a Kimberley tied house and there were two real ales on the bar i had a drink of Kimberley bitter and this was a decent drink the other beer was Kimberley mild.
This pub is more than likely a GK house now.
